It's also not the last time it happens, either. I watched the video to see what was going on, after Alph deleted HSM1's post. After Rogue absorbed her (including her persona), Rogue and Wolverine were kidnapped and lost access to their powers. The people who kidnapped them raped her. She was pretty much catatonic, and Ms. Marvel temporarily took over Rogue's body to get them out of there, since Rogue was mentally unable to. She and Wolverine, after powers were restored, also murdered everyone who violated Rogue (and technically Ms. Marvel) in that way. Claremont also wrote that story. So...Yeah. There you go. It's available in the Essential X-Men graphic novels, either book 3 or 4, I forgot which. I think it's 4. It's been two years since I've read it though. The part that I laughed about was Claremont being pissed and doing justice to her-because he later let it happen again, as a prisoner of war, instead of mind control!! Same character, different body!! People shouldn't be giving Claremont props in this matter. I will give him props for saving the X-Men though, after Stan Lee sorta ran them into the ground.

edit-I just went to look it up, and apparently Claremont publically said "she was only touched badly, not actually raped". But it was heavily hinted at being rape, and then called as only being molested. You'll find both viewpoints online. Just Google Rogue being raped on Genosha, and you can determine for yourself if she actually was and he tried to backpedal on it, or if his answer is legit.

H.B.M.C. wrote:It featured Tony Stark as a mustache-twirling villain. That was the problem. Civil War should have been about competing ideologies. Instead it was just black and white/hero vs villain, and they made former heroes into villains to make that work.

Not just Tony, but Reed (who has always been kind of a tool, but not an evil one) and a few others.


Ahtman wrote:I think he started out a bit less overt, but comics often have trouble with nuance so writers ended up ramping it up.

Actually iirc there was an interview with Millar in which the original idea was that Cap was the bad guy. Iron Man was supposed to be using common sense and consideration and for once Steve Rogers was supposed to be on the wrong side of something, even if unintentionally. It didn't end up working out that way of course as everyone, other writers included, assumed Iron Man was in the wrong and Cap was in the right an ran with it.

Except there is pretty much no universe in which Cap COULD be the bad guy in this. Especially after all the times Mutant Registration was used as a negative plot device; i.e., something that HAD TO BE STOPPED AT ALL COSTS OMG! Suddenly putting a new face on it doesn't change the numerous YEARS of that lesson, especially when entire comics have been devoted to how horrible registration invariably ends up. Days of Future Past being the primest of prime examples.

Also lets be real here. Having Captain Frelling America taken down by the NYPD and FDNY is up there among the worst bits of writing in human history.
